q4. what is the formula mass (fm) for cobalt(iii) chlorate, co(clo3)3?
a) 110.38 amu
b) 309.28 amu
c) 331.16 amu
d) 250.35 amu
Step1: Identify atomic masses
The atomic mass of Co (cobalt) is approximately 58.93 amu, Cl (chlorine) is approximately 35.45 amu, and O (oxygen) is approximately 16.00 amu.
Step2: Calculate mass from formula
In $Co(ClO_3)_3$, there is 1 Co atom, 3 Cl atoms, and 9 O atoms.
The contribution of Co: $1\times58.93$ amu = 58.93 amu.
The contribution of Cl: $3\times35.45$ amu = 106.35 amu.
The contribution of O: $9\times16.00$ amu = 144.00 amu.
Step3: Sum up the masses
$FM=58.93 + 106.35+144.00$ amu = 309.28 amu.
